在linux中搭建FTP服务器,但虚拟用户不能访问
我使用的版本是RHEL4.8的版本
具体步骤:
1、首先给装FTP的linux服务器配置一个static地址 192.168.9.1,因为是在两台桥接的虚拟机中实验没有配置网关和DNS。
2、挂在光盘 mout /dev/cdrom /media
3、rpm -ivh /media/RedHat/RPMS/vsftpd-* --nodeps --replacepkgs
4、编辑了一个虚拟用户文件
vi /etc/vsftpd/zonic.txt
tom
123
jack
123
5、转化文件格式,把zonic.txt 转换成 zonic.db
db_load -T -t hash -f /etc/vsftpd/zonic.txt /etc/vsftpd/zonic.db
6、建立PAM认证文件
vi /etc/pam.d/ftp.v
auth required /lib/security/pam_userdb.so db=/etc/vsftpd/zonic
account required /lib/security/pam_userdb.so db=/etc/vsftpd/zonic
7、useradd -d /home/ftpsite v1
8、vi /etc/vsftpd/vsftpd.conf
guest_enable=yes
guest_username=v1
pam_service_name=ftp.v
anon_other_write_enable=yes
9、service vsftpd start
10、 chmod 775 /home/ftpsite
这些就是具体的设置 其他的都开了 允许匿名用户登陆什么的
客户端是一个XP系统的 ip=192.168.9.11
两台机子是能PING的通的 相互
但就是访问不ftp 服务器
请知道的兄弟能赐教下 感激不尽。
具体步骤:
1、首先给装FTP的linux服务器配置一个static地址 192.168.9.1,因为是在两台桥接的虚拟机中实验没有配置网关和DNS。
2、挂在光盘 mout /dev/cdrom /media
3、rpm -ivh /media/RedHat/RPMS/vsftpd-* --nodeps --replacepkgs
4、编辑了一个虚拟用户文件
vi /etc/vsftpd/zonic.txt
tom
123
jack
123
5、转化文件格式,把zonic.txt 转换成 zonic.db
db_load -T -t hash -f /etc/vsftpd/zonic.txt /etc/vsftpd/zonic.db
6、建立PAM认证文件
vi /etc/pam.d/ftp.v
auth required /lib/security/pam_userdb.so db=/etc/vsftpd/zonic
account required /lib/security/pam_userdb.so db=/etc/vsftpd/zonic
7、useradd -d /home/ftpsite v1
8、vi /etc/vsftpd/vsftpd.conf
guest_enable=yes
guest_username=v1
pam_service_name=ftp.v
anon_other_write_enable=yes
9、service vsftpd start
10、 chmod 775 /home/ftpsite
这些就是具体的设置 其他的都开了 允许匿名用户登陆什么的
客户端是一个XP系统的 ip=192.168.9.11
两台机子是能PING的通的 相互
但就是访问不ftp 服务器
请知道的兄弟能赐教下 感激不尽。
作者: 馬小海 发布时间: 2011-11-27
在那错的话 请提示下 急求啊 !
江湖告急啊!!!!!!!!!!!!!!!
江湖告急啊!!!!!!!!!!!!!!!
作者: 馬小海 发布时间: 2011-11-29